The City of High Point Community Development Committee met on June 2, 2026, to discuss updates and actions related to community gardening and property conveyance. The committee received an annual update on the community and school garden program, highlighting grant distributions totaling approximately $970 to support 18 gardens, which provided a fair market value benefit of about $4,690 to recipients. The city funds these materials through its community development budget, effectively saving gardeners money. Additionally, the committee considered and approved a resolution to convey city-owned property at 722 Washington Street to D Up Inc., a nonprofit organization, to facilitate a community garden and future low-to-moderate income housing development. The motion to approve the conveyance passed unanimously and will be forwarded to the full city council for final approval. The committee also confirmed ongoing leasing of city lots to nonprofit organizations for community gardening purposes.
